Musician Grimes appears to have confirmed that she and her partner, billionaire and Tesla owner Elon Musk, are going to have a baby.
The Canadian singer, who is actually called Claire Boucher, appeared to announce the good news in an uncensored Instagram photo that showed her stomach with the outline of a foetus photoshopped onto it.

Then - thanks to Instagram's rules about showing female nipples - the photo was deleted and replaced with a censored version.
Anyway, in a comment underneath the now-deleted original photograph, Grimes seemed to confirm that she and Musk are to become parents, writing: "I thought about censoring them for a hot minute haha (this may get taken down anyway) but the photo is so much less feral without the nipples.
"Plus being knocked up is a very feral & war-like state of being.
"Might as well be what it is. Plus most of my friends told me not to post them so then I was afflicted w reverse psychology.
"Interrogated my shame on it and decided it was sum weird internalized self hatred to feel uncomfortable abt my body."
As she expected, it did eventually get taken down.
She then posted the censored version of the photograph with the caption: "Censored for insta haha - almost got away [with it]."
While this is Boucher's first child, 48-year-old entrepreneur Musk already has five children, a set of twins and a set of triplets, with his first wife Justine Wilson, who he divorced in 2008.
He has subsequently been married twice to British actor Talulah Riley, before they divorced for the second time in 2016.
Musk, who owns rocket and spacecraft manufacturer SpaceX as well as his electric car and energy company Tesla, is worth a reported $29.2bn (£22.3bn).
He and Grimes have been together since May 2018.
In the caption for her original picture, Grimes made light of the fact that she has been accused of being a gold digger, despite being a successful artist in her own right.
She wrote: "Omg queen of securing elons coin forreal ... #businesswoman."
